摘  要:文章根据2019年的安溪青洋下草埔冶铁遗址考古发掘情况以及实验室检测结果,总结出下草埔冶场具有生铁冶炼和块炼铁冶炼两种冶炼模式共存、冶铁炉多样、周边资源丰富、存在有规划的板结层、出土文物种类多等特点,该地区制造的主要外销产品包括生铁产品、块炼铁产品、钢产品以及间接用于炼银的中间产品4类。整个区域的内外被贯穿其中的水路及陆路交通运输系统紧密相连在一起,呈现出海港经济体和乡村腹地手工业体系高度一体化的空间布局和整体形态。下草埔冶铁遗址对研究我国古代冶铁技术以及泉州海上丝绸之路有着重要意义,今后的研究应将重点放在遗址遗物特点、遗址形成、展览展示和调整调查对象和范围上。According to the archaeological excavation and laboratory test results of Xiacaopu iron smelting site in Qingyang,Anxi in 2019,this paper summarizes that Xiacaopu iron smelting site has the characteristics of coexistence of pig iron smelting and block iron smelting,diversified iron smelting furnaces,rich surrounding resources and many kinds of unearthed cultural relics and so on.The main export products manufactured in this area include pig iron products,block ironmaking products,steel products and intermediate products indirectly used for silver smelting.The whole region is closely connected with the waterway and land transportation system.The spatial layout and overall form are highly integrated with the handicraft industry system in the rural hinterland and the harbor economy.Xiacaopu iron smelting site is of great significance to the study of ancient iron smelting technology in China and Quanzhou Maritime Silk Road.In future research,we should focus on the characteristics of relics,site formation,exhibition and adjustment of investigation objects and scope.
